Brahms was hailed by Schumann as “the rightful heir to the mantle of Beethoven.” His First Symphony is a worthy successor with its dramatic strength, lyrical power and triumphant soundscape – it is arguably one of the greatest first symphonies ever written. Composer-in-Residence Peter Boyer’s vibrant universe of sound takes center with Apollo and Grammy Award nominee Caroline Goulding performs the Sibelius Violin Concerto, which contrasts the dark, dreamy and reflective with an air of passionate urgency, gypsy dance and boundless virtuosity.
